France captain Kylian Mbappe has come to the defence of Ousmane Dembele following criticism of the winger’s performance against Senegal.
Speaking ahead of France’s second World Cup fixture against Iraq, the Real Madrid star insisted his teammate’s influence extends far beyond goals and assists.
Mbappe argued that while he and Michael Olise grabbed the headlines in the second half, Dembele was France’s most dangerous attacking player during the opening 45 minutes.
Alo, he pointed to his status as one of the world’s elite players, stressing that his value to the team remains unquestionable.
"Ousmane? I have watched the game back twice; in the first half he was the best of the four in attack, the one who stood out the most,” Mbappe told the media.
“In the second half, Michael and I were decisive, but he also contributed. He drew in an opponent and left free space for the first goal.
“Ousmane is very calm, he is the Ballon d'Or winner, he has everyone's confidence. I am sure that, starting from tomorrow, he will move forward again. He is going to be a fundamental player for us, that is for sure."
